How Much Does it Cost to Rent a Porta Loo?
The cost of renting a porta loo (also known as a portable toilet) varies significantly depending on several factors. There's no single answer, but understanding these influencing factors will help you get a realistic price estimate for your needs. This guide will break down the cost and answer frequently asked questions.
Factors Affecting Porta Loo Rental Costs:
-
Rental Duration: The longer you rent a porta loo, the lower the daily or weekly rate often becomes. A weekend rental will generally be more expensive per day than a month-long rental.
-
Type of Porta Loo: Basic porta loos are the most affordable. However, more luxurious options, such as those with handwashing facilities, flushable toilets, or ADA-compliant features, will cost significantly more. Luxury units might even include climate control for added comfort.
-
Location: Rental costs can vary geographically. Urban areas typically have higher rental rates due to increased demand and transportation costs. Rural areas might offer slightly lower prices. Delivery distance also plays a role; longer distances mean higher transportation fees.
-
Delivery and Setup: Most rental companies include delivery and setup in their quotes, but it's crucial to confirm this upfront. Some might charge extra for difficult access locations or require additional fees for setup on uneven terrain.
-
Cleaning Frequency: The price will reflect the cleaning schedule you require. More frequent cleaning naturally increases the overall cost.
H2: How much does a basic porta loo rental typically cost?
The price of a standard porta loo rental typically ranges from $100 to $300 per unit per week. Daily rates can be higher, often between $20 and $50 per day, but this frequently changes based on the factors listed above. Keep in mind this is a broad estimate; getting quotes directly from local rental companies is essential for accurate pricing.
H2: What is the cost of renting a luxury porta loo?
Luxury porta loos, offering features like handwashing stations, flushable toilets, and climate control, command a much higher price. Expect to pay anywhere from $150 to $500 or more per week for these premium units. The exact cost depends on the specific features and location.

H2: Are there any additional costs involved in renting a porta loo?
Beyond the base rental fee, you might encounter additional charges for:
- Delivery and pickup: While often included, confirm this detail with your provider. Additional fees may apply for remote locations or difficult access.
- Service fees: These can cover regular servicing and waste removal.
- Damages: Costs associated with damage to the unit are your responsibility.
- Taxes: Local taxes might be added to the final bill.
